Alejandro Aravena(1967)

Alejandro Aravena is a recipient of the Pritzker Architecture Prize (2016) from Chile. They were educated at Accademia di Belle Arti di Venezia and Pontifical Catholic University of Chile. They have been affiliated with Harvard Graduate School of Design.
